This bright, waterfront home is everything you've been waiting for in a Lake Chelan retreat. With large windows throughout the villa, you'll have a lake view from every room! The full kitchen is loaded with all the stainless steel appliances and amenities you'll need to prepare an amazing homecooked meal. Step outside to the patio where you'll find a gas grill, a large table for al fresco dining, lounge chairs, a hot tub, and 71 feet of water frontage. This home also offers a private dock for daytime boat moorage and three buoys for overnight moorage.
What’s nearby: After a day on the lake, slow things down with a wine tasting and lunch at one of the numerous wineries in the area including Karma, Fielding Hills, Siren Song, Nefarious! The Lake Chelan State Park awaits just four miles west and is the perfect spot to launch a boat, let the kids run at the playground, or hike the Little Bear Trail. Tee off at Bear Mountain Ranch Golf Course, located just under five miles away or the Lake Chelan Municipal Golf Course, located in town. Gamble Sands and Desert Canyon are also great options for a round of 18. Head into the charming town of Chelan, just six miles away, for shopping, great dining options, paddleboard or boat rentals, and family fun at Slidewaters.

Great overall trip. Parking is limited and the road down to the house is very narrow and no place to turn around if you drive a truck. We brought all our stuff in by boat and parked the truck and trailer at the top of the road. Other than that and a 10:00am checkout it is a very nice spot right on the lake. If you do bring a boat make sure you have a long bow line (10’-15’) to tie up to the buoy and check the weather for wind conditions. Your boat will get the waves from the wind, other boat traffic, and the wave rebound off the bulkhead. We would tie up to the main dock to load and unload and then take the boat out to the buoy for the day.
